Other nuts (excluding wild edible nuts and groundnuts), in shell in Land Locked Developing Countries (LLDCs)
Land Locked Developing Countries (LLDCs): Other nuts (excluding wild edible nuts and groundnuts), in shell was 32,346 1000 USD in 2024. ▲ Rising
Other nuts (excluding wild edible nuts and groundnuts), in shell in Land Locked Developing Countries (LLDCs), 1991–2024
Source: Food and Agriculture Organization of the United Nations. Measured in 1000 USD.
Analysis
In 2024, other nuts (excluding wild edible nuts and groundnuts), in shell in Land Locked Developing Countries (LLDCs) stood at 32,346 1000 USD.
Compared with earlier readings it is down 16.5% on the previous year and down 40.4% over ten years.
Over the whole period, other nuts (excluding wild edible nuts and groundnuts), in shell in Land Locked Developing Countries (LLDCs) peaked at 73,586 1000 USD in 2008 and was at its lowest, 1,369 1000 USD, in 1991.
Land Locked Developing Countries (LLDCs) ranks 18th of 25 groups on this measure, in the middle of the range.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 34 years of available data.

About this data
The domain provides detailed data on the value of agricultural production that is calculated by the agricultural production data and the price data at farm gate. Thus, the value of production measures the agricultural production in monetary terms at the farm gate level.
